Output 66b48f09fb5340e4083e3618a1f208af6a63792f70a733e38e6155201083ab72:0

value
18786604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688b3be8b2a00131f2a65d7b0a7b110cbe1de02b OP_EQUAL
address
3BDnzeGcCXUccRNyz198tq1NS1ekE7ZBAW
transaction
66b48f09fb5340e4083e3618a1f208af6a63792f70a733e38e6155201083ab72
spent
true